How Our Antimicrobial Treatment Services Work
At the heart of our Antimicrobial Treatment Services is a meticulous process that ensures every inch of your property is treated and protected. We understand that corners cut in this process can lead to re-growth re-infestation and even long-term health risks for you and your loved ones.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of your property to identify the source and extent of the microbial growth. We’ll then take steps to contain the affected area to prevent further spread, including sealing off affected rooms and setting up negative air pressure.
Step 2: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use specialized equipment to thoroughly sanitize and disinfect all surfaces, including walls ceilings floors and fixtures to remove any remaining microorganisms.
Step 3: Antimicrobial Treatment
Next, our team will apply a specialized antimicrobial treatment to all affected areas to prevent re-growth and re-infestation. This treatment is designed to target and remove even the toughest microorganisms.
Step 4: Drying and Ventilation
Finally, we’ll work to dry out the affected area and improve ventilation to prevent future growth and ensure your home remains safe and healthy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Clearance
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ure all microorganisms have been eliminated and your home is safe for occupancy. We’ll also provide you with a detailed report and recommendations for future maintenance to prevent re-infestation.

Warning Signs You Need Antimicrobial Treatment Services
Don’t ignore these common warning signs that show you need Antimicrobial Treatment Services to protect your home and your family’s health: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ant musty odors that linger even after cleaning and disinfecting are a clear sign of microbial growth. If you notice these odors, it’s time to call our team to take care of the issue before it gets worse.
Visible Signs of Fungal Growth
Black spots, white patches, or yellowish streaks on walls, ceilings, or floors are all signs of fungal growth that need immediate attention. Our team has the expertise to identify and remove these growths before they spread.
Excessive Dust or Water Stains
Excessive dust, water stains, or water damage in your home can be indicative of microbial growth.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to contact our team to prevent further damage and health risks.
Increased Allergy Symptoms
Suddenly experiencing increased allergy symptoms, such as sneezing, coughing, or congestion, can be a sign of microbial growth in your home. Our team can help you identify and remove the source of these issues.
Unexplained Fatigue or Health Issues
Experiencing unexplained fatigue, headaches, or other health issues can be linked to microbial growth in your home. If you’re concerned about your health, contact our team to get your home tested and treated.
Infestation of Pests or Rodents
Seeing pests or rodents in your home can be a sign of microbial growth that’s attracting these unwanted critters. Our team can help you remove the source of the issue and prevent future infestations.
Visible Mold or Mildew
Visible mold or mildew growth on walls, ceilings, or floors is a clear sign of microbial growth that needs immediate attention. Our team has the expertise to identify and remove these growths before they spread.
